Output d7575d5524d8a5241512c5dfea6c3ba9454e3e433aac2dd6b9809c52b7a48306:0

value
22266756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4904d134bca82db7be45774a830ad54c948c98ca OP_EQUAL
address
MEZFL93WVDZXg1FQuArSp6YuAwj5vCpXw6
transaction
d7575d5524d8a5241512c5dfea6c3ba9454e3e433aac2dd6b9809c52b7a48306
spent
true